Embodiment

[0030] like figure 1 As shown, the embodiment of the present invention includes a car body 2, a dust suppression system and a dust suction system.

[0031] The dust suppression system includes an air cylinder 1 , an atomizing fan, an atomizing nozzle 16 , a water pipe 19 , a water tank 11 and a water pump 20 .

[0032] The atomizing fan is arranged in the air cylinder 1, and the atomizing nozzle 16 is arranged on the axis of one side of the atomizing fan near the air outlet of the air cylinder 1, and the atomizing nozzle 16 passes through the The water delivery pipe 19 is connected to the water tank 11 , and the water pump 20 is provided at the end of the water delivery pipe 19 .

[0033] The dust suction system includes a dust suction duct 17 , a dust collection box 4 and a dust suction blower 22 .

Abstract

The invention discloses a remote control type tunnel construction self-adaptive dust suction and falling integrated device, and relates to the field of dust removal equipment. According to the technical scheme, the remote control type tunnel construction self-adaptive dust suction and falling integrated device comprises a vehicle body, a dust falling system and a dust suction system; the dust falling system comprises an air duct, an atomizing fan, an atomizing nozzle, a water conveying pipe, a water tank and a water pump; the dust collection system comprises a dust collection pipeline, a dust collection box and a dust collection fan; the air outlet end of the dust suction pipeline communicates with the dust suction box, and the dust suction fan and the dust removal assembly are arranged in the dust suction box. The dust collection box and the dust falling function port of the dust collection box are of the same structure, namely an air duct, after the position angle is adjusted, the dust collection and dust removal modes can be flexibly selected, the position of the vehicle body does not need to be adjusted again, the dust removal modes are rich, and the efficiency is higher.

Description

technical field [0001] The invention relates to a remote-controlled tunnel construction self-adaptive dust-absorbing integrated device, and mainly relates to the field of dust-removing equipment. Background technique [0002] During the construction of drill-and-blast tunnels, the working surface is narrow and the ventilation conditions are poor. The dust generated during the construction and production process is not easy to disperse, which has a serious impact on the health of the workers. At present, exhaust fans or blowers and other equipment are generally used to dilute tunnel dust. However, in special cases such as long-distance tunnels or near working surfaces, fixed fans still have problems such as insufficient conveying capacity and high maintenance costs. However, most of the existing portable ventilation devices need to be manually operated by construction personnel, and the dust removal method is single, and the effect of dust removal is slow.
